Easy Mexican Rice Recipe



If you’ve been out to your favorite Mexican restaurant and love the delicious rice, you can make the same dish in your own kitchen. Here’s an easy recipe that works as a nice side dish. Grill some fish, beef or chicken….make a few tacos, add a side of beans and you have a delicious meal!
Hint: This can easily be made in a rice cooker.  You still want to brown the rice on the stove. When it’s time to add the tomato sauce, broth and cilantro, you’ll then place all the ingredients into the rice cooker and cook as you would normally do for steamed rice.

Ingredients
  • 3 Tbsp. vegetable oil
  • 1 cup long grain rice, uncooked
  • 1 tsp. fresh minced garlic
  • 1/2 tsp. kosher salt
  • 1/2 tsp. cumin
  • 1/2 c. tomato sauce
  • 1 (14 oz) can chicken broth or stock
  • 3 Tbsp. finely chopped fresh cilantro

  • Heat oil in a large saucepan over medium heat. Add the rice and gently stir until rice begins to lightly brown. Add the garlic, salt, and cumin and stir the rice until it looks golden. Add the tomato sauce, chicken broth, and cilantro and turn the heat up to medium high. Bring the mix to a boil then turn the heat to low and cover the pan with a lid. Simmer for 20 to 25 minutes. Remove from heat and fluff with a fork. Serves 4.
